     War Eagle, everybody! This morning, the Auburn Tigers visit Oxford, Mississippi to take on the Ole Miss rebels in an important SEC battle. Auburn looks to avoid having the first 3-game losing streak in the Gus Malzahn era, and desperately needs a win to become bowl-eligible.

     This game will kick off at 11:00 AM, Central Time, on ESPN. Lots of eyes will be watching this one, on the main channel of the cable giant. Fortunately for Auburn, Oxford has not proved to be too tough a venue for Auburn in the modern era. In my lifetime, Auburn has a record of 11-3 in that fair city. The losses all came in losing seasons for Auburn, in 1992, 2008 and 2012.

     At kickoff for this one, temperatures should be around 60F, rising to the mid-60s when this one ends around 2:30 PM. There is a slight chance for an early shower in this one, but the sky should be clearing as the game progresses.
